Re: Vector graphics within PDFs ?
Ian Castle wrote:
>
> With ImageMagick you can do:
>
> convert fig.eps fig.epdf
>
> This converts from Encaps. PS to Encaps. PDF (PDF with a bounding box).
> then
>
> mv fig.epdf fig.pdf
Ok, this works, i guess, but you still convert vector based into raster
based,
right?
What about including the actual vector data in PDF? Or, does the FOP
mechanism
(source -> FOP -> PDF) support SVG, for example?
